This is your travel guide for Comstock, Kalamazoo, Michigan

1 : Visit the Kalamazoo Nature Center [2 hrs]
Explore the 1,100-acre nature preserve with over 14 miles of hiking trails, interactive exhibits, and a bird observation room. Learn about the local flora and fauna, attend nature programs, and participate in seasonal events like maple sugar festivals.

2 : Tour the Gilmore Car Museum [2 hrs]
Marvel at the collection of over 400 vintage automobiles, including classic cars, muscle cars, and iconic vehicles from different eras. Enjoy guided tours, special exhibits, and events such as car shows and vintage car rides. Visit the reconstructed historic dealerships on the campus.

3 : Attend a performance at the Miller Auditorium [3 hrs]
Experience world-class concerts, Broadway shows, ballet performances, and more at this renowned performing arts venue. Enjoy modern facilities, comfortable seating, and acoustics suited for a wide range of performances. Check the schedule for upcoming shows and book tickets in advance.

4 : Explore the Kalamazoo Institute of Arts [2 hrs]
Admire an extensive collection of artworks, including paintings, sculptures, prints, and decorative arts from various time periods. Attend art classes, workshops, and special events held at the institute. Discover the permanent collection and rotating exhibitions showcasing regional and international artists.

5 : Shop and dine at Crossroads Mall [2 hrs]
Browse through a variety of shops offering clothing, accessories, electronics, and more. Indulge in diverse cuisine options at the food court or dine at one of the restaurants within the mall. Take a break and enjoy a cup of coffee or a sweet treat at one of the cafes.

Background Info

Weather
Comstock experiences cold winters with temperatures averaging around 20°F (-6.7°C) and mild summers with temperatures around 80°F (26.7°C). The area receives moderate rainfall throughout the year with higher precipitation during the summer months. Humidity levels vary but generally remain moderate. Air quality is considered good in the area.

Language
English is the primary language spoken in Comstock, Michigan.

Cost Of Living
The cost of living index in Comstock is slightly below the national average, making it an affordable place to reside. Housing costs, healthcare, and transportation expenses are generally reasonable compared to other parts of the United States.

Other
Comstock Township offers a mix of suburban and rural living, providing residents with access to amenities while being close to nature. The area is known for its friendly community, family-friendly atmosphere, and opportunities for outdoor recreation such as hiking, biking, and nature appreciation.
